Code Ann. § 26-18-212","heading":"Failure to file a return after notification","body":"If a taxpayer has previously been advised that the taxpayer has not complied with the provisions of § 26-51-804(a) , § 26-51-908(g)(2) , § 26-52-501(a) , § 26-53-125(a)(1) , or § 26-55-229(b) , because the taxpayer has not filed a return or notified the Secretary of the Department of Finance and Administration that the taxpayer is no longer required to file a return, even though no tax is due, and the taxpayer continues to disregard those provisions, there shall be assessed a penalty of fifty dollars ($50.00) per return, unless the failure is due to reasonable cause and not due to willful neglect.","path":["AR Code","Title 26","Chapter 18","Subchapter 2"],"source_url":"https://oss-data-us.vaquill.ai/v2026.08/us_ar_statutes.parquet","current_through":"2026-08-14","vintage":"open-us-law v2026.08, retrieved 2026-09-14","retrieved_at":"2026-09-14T18:32:41Z","sha256":"54613294c7c9fb61c96199ffbd4743164ab2e8d2cf21975997e5ceca25aabab7","source_id":"us-ar","stale":false,"prev":"us-ar/ark.-code-ann.-26-18-211","next":"us-ar/ark.-code-ann.-26-18-301"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
